The Senior Oracle ERP Business Analyst is responsible for leading functional design, configuration, testing, and support of Oracle EBS supply chain modules. Acts as the primary bridge between supply chain stakeholders and IT/technical teams to deliver solutions that improve order-to-cash, procure-to-pay and inventory/manufacturing processes. Focus on requirements gathering, gap analysis, solution design (config and interfaces), UAT, and post go live support.

What You Will Do:

  • Partner with supply chain leadership (planning, procurement, inventory, order management, logistics, manufacturing) to understand business processes and pain points.
  • Lead requirements gathering, process mapping, gap analysis, and identify configuration vs. customization decisions.
  • Design and configure Oracle EBS Supply Chain modules such as Inventory (INV), Order Management (OM), Purchasing (PO), iProcurement, Receiving, Work in Process (WIP), Bills of Material (BOM), Cost Management, Advanced Supply Chain Planning (ASCP)/MRP, and Warehouse Management (WMS) if applicable.
  • Create functional specifications for integrations, interfaces, reports, conversions, and extensions (FBDI, SQL, PL/SQL, APIs, Web Services, flat-file, EDI).
  • Collaborate with developers and integration teams to ensure solutions meet functional requirements; review technical designs and participate in code/solution walkthroughs.
  • Define and execute test plans: unit testing, integration testing, user acceptance testing (UAT); coordinate defect triage and resolution.
  • Prepare and deliver training materials, run training sessions and produce user documentation and SOPs.
  • Support cutover planning and execution for deployments and upgrades.
  • Analyze production issues, perform root-cause analysis, propose fixes and process improvements.
  • Maintain knowledge of Oracle EBS patches and module-specific enhancements; recommend upgrades or new features where beneficial.
  • Mentor junior analysts and provide guidance on best practices and governance.

What You Need to Succeed: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Information Systems, Computer Science, Business Administration, Supply Chain Management, or related field.
  • 6+ years’ experience implementing/supporting Oracle EBS Supply Chain modules; 3+ years in a senior or lead analyst role preferred.
  • 30% travel and up to 50% during project execution
  • Must have ability to identify customer needs, and understand how to deliver business value through the design of strong solutions
  • Ability to learn industry specific software, and proficiency with Microsoft Office tools
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Experience in manufacturing and/or distribution industry
  • Experience in Oracle EBS 11i and R12
  • Deep functional expertise in at least four of the following: Inventory, Order Management, Purchasing/Procurement, WIP/BOM, Costing, WMS, ASCP/MRP.
  • Strong understanding of end-to-end supply chain processes: order-to-cash, procure-to-pay, demand planning, inventory management and fulfillment.
  • Hands-on experience producing functional designs, test scripts, user guides, and training materials.
  • Experience with integrations, familiarity with Oracle Adapter frameworks and middleware is a plus.
  • Ability to use Oracle SQL for troubleshooting and data analysis.
  • Experience with Oracle EBS upgrade projects, patching and module enhancements is preferred.

Technical and soft skills

  • Technical: Oracle EBS modules. Oracle SQL, basic PL/SQL, Oracle Forms/Apps knowledge, knowledge of reporting tools (BI Publisher, OTBI) is a plus, data conversion and integration approaches.
  • Analytical: strong problem solving, process modeling, gap analysis and requirements translation skills.
  • Communication: excellent written and verbal communication; ability to engage at business and technical levels.
  • Project skills: experience with Agile and Waterfall delivery methods, ability to manage competing priorities and stakeholder expectations.
  • Leadership: mentoring experience, ability to lead workshops and facilitate cross-functional alignment.

Certifications (preferred)

  • Oracle E-Business Suite Supply Chain certifications (e.g., Oracle Inventory, Order Management)
  • APICS/CPIM, CSCP or other supply chain certifications

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
